  • Affordable, and from a Good Brand: For a brand name 37-inch LCD TV, the Toshiba 37H67 is remarkably affordable. We're certain that this is a deal you'll have a hard time beating.
  • Attractive Design: The Toshiba 37HL67 knows that a TV is more than just a TV, it's a part of your home. The attractive, piano-black gloss and slim design of this HDTV will blend nicely into your living room, and provide an added touch of class.
  • Astounding Contrast Ratio: With all the talk about HDTV resolution, it's easy to forget how important it is to have deep, deep blacks, and how crucial they are to a good picture. This Sharp TV has a wonderful contrast ratio, which will greatly enhance your viewing experience.
  • User Friendly: Actual owners of this 37" Sharp HDTV consistently praise the intuitive menus, easy-to use remote control, and straightforward connections, saying it's never frustrating or confusing to change settings or hookups.
  • Special "Game Mode": Hardcore gamers will appreciate the optimized game mode, which claims to improve graphics and give your gameplay an added boost.
  • Finely Tuned Picture: This Sharp won't let you down when it comes to picture quality, with outstanding stats for response time, brightness, and contrast ratio.
